CPR BLS Certification Course in Garland, TX for Healthcare Providers

The BLS Certification Course is the starting point for most healthcare professionals in Garland and across Dallas County. It covers high-quality chest compressions, rescue breathing, two-rescuer CPR, and hands-on AED use — with an emphasis on coordinated team response in clinical settings. Nurses and support staff at area facilities like Baylor Scott & White – Garland or UT Southwestern-affiliated clinics will find the curriculum maps directly to what they encounter on shift. Upon successful completion, participants receive an AHA Course Completion eCard accepted by hospitals and employers throughout Texas.

PALS Certification Course in Garland, TX for Pediatric Emergencies

Pediatric emergencies follow their own rules, and providers who work with infants and children need training that reflects that reality. The PALS Certification Course focuses on systematic assessment of critically ill pediatric patients — covering respiratory distress, shock states, and cardiopulmonary arrest — with an emphasis on early recognition and rapid stabilization.

Pediatric nurses, pediatricians, emergency providers, and anyone who may encounter a child in crisis will gain practical skills and renewed confidence through this course. CPR Verification Station™ Skills Sessions in Garland, TX

The CPR Verification Station™ at Safety Training Seminars gives students a fast, structured way to validate their hands-on CPR skills after completing online coursework. Using objective measurement technology, the station provides real-time feedback on compression depth, rate, recoil, and ventilation — removing subjectivity from the skills assessment process.

For professionals who’ve already completed the cognitive portion of their BLS or HeartCode® course, the Verification Station™ session is typically brief and streamlined. You demonstrate your skills, receive objective confirmation of competency, and walk out with your AHA Course Completion eCard — no lengthy waiting, no ambiguity. Who Needs BLS CPR, ACLS & PALS Courses?

Life-saving skills belong to a broader community than most people realize. Healthcare workers — nurses, physicians, respiratory therapists, and medical assistants — are obvious candidates, but the need extends well beyond hospital walls. Dentists and dental hygienists are required to maintain BLS credentials in most states. Paramedics, EMTs, and firefighters throughout Garland rely on up-to-date ACLS and PALS skills to manage complex calls in the field.

Physical therapists, occupational therapists, and other allied health professionals often need BLS as a condition of licensure renewal. Ski patrol, athletic trainers, and community first responders benefit from the same core curriculum. Students in nursing, medicine, and emergency medicine programs need certification before clinical rotations begin.

And beyond the clinical world — caregivers of elderly or medically fragile family members, school administrators, coaches, fitness instructors, and members of the general public — anyone who wants to be genuinely prepared when an emergency happens nearby will find real value in these courses.
